Compression Fails

I am attempting to compress a file.  I have made many edits in this file over the years, mainly changing highlight colors.  As more changes accumulate, performance slows, for example selecting text takes a few seconds.  In the past, I have resolved the performance issue by compressing the file about once per year.  I purchased a yearly subscription for the sole purpose of compressing this one file when necessary.

 

My most recent attempts to compress this file result in the error Failure Compressing PDF after the compression attempt has been running for maybe a minute.  I have tried all three options for the compression size.  

 

The file is about ten pages long, all text. The file is stored in the Adobe cloud.

 

Anything else I can try before I give up and cancel my subscription?

Is this an issue with a particular PDF file or with all the PDFs? Please try with a different PDF file and check.

 

Given that your PDF is stored in the Adobe cloud and has a long history of edits (especially highlight changes), it’s possible that the file has accumulated some complexity or minor corruption over time, which may be causing the compression to fail.

 

Try downloading the PDF to your device, opening the local copy, and try compressing it directly. If successful, upload the compressed version back to the cloud.

 

You can also use “Print to PDF” (option in Acrobat desktop app) to create a clean copy. This helps flatten annotations and clear any hidden metadata:

1. Open the PDF and go to Print > Adobe PDF (choose “Adobe PDF” as the printer).

2. This will generate a new “flattened” version of the file.

3. Try compressing this new version.

Note: This method may remove editable annotations, so double-check the new file to ensure everything looks good.
